Municipality of North Cowichan North Cowichan is a community on south Vancouver Island, and about 32,000 call North Cowichan home.

Social media code of conduct: https://www.northcowichan.ca/privacy-statement North Cowichan is a diverse Municipality which includes a number of distinct communities (South End, Crofton, Chemainus, and Maple Bay). Located between Victoria and Nanaimo in the heart of the Cowichan Valley, the Municipality offers a serene, easy-going lifestyle among forest lands, mountains, lakes, rivers, and ocean i

nlets. North Cowichan offers an enticing variety of recreational pursuits. While the forest industry has been a backbone of the local economy, the 5,000 hectare municipal forest reserve also provides great hiking, mountain biking, hang gliding, and nature viewing opportunities. Scuba diving, sailing and fishing are also possible in the waters of Genoa Bay, Maple Bay, Sansum Narrows, and Stuart Channel. Lush, fertile farm and forest lands weave into the fabric of North Cowichan's rich, rural atmosphere. The famous Chemainus Murals have inspired many communities in Canada to explore their roots. Bursting with charm and charisma, Chemainus draws over 500,000 visitors annually from all over the world.

Emergency Management Cowichan has shared an update on the Gala Vista apartment fire, including information about local agencies collecting monetary donations to support those affected. See full details below.

Repairs and cleanup work for the Gala Vista Apartments are expected to take about 2 weeks. Residents on the first, third, and fourth floors should be able to return to their suites after that time. Tenants on the second floor will be instructed on the duration of return later this week.

On Wednesday August 26, 2026, residents will be allowed to come to the site and collect small personal items from their apartment. Tenants from floors 1 and 2 are asked to arrive at 10 a.m., and tenants on floors 3 and 4 at 12:30 p.m. Staff will es**rt residents to their suites, and residents must wear personal protective equipment (N95 masks).

EM Cowichan will continue providing shelter and accommodation support for all evacuated residents for the next 2 weeks while repairs are underway. The EMC Emergency Support Services (ESS) team will contact evacuees later this week to confirm these arrangements.

EMC is not accepting donations. Evacuees can contact us for the phone number for the Free Store and get in touch with the Cowichan Valley Basket Society for extra help with food.

If you would like to donate, the Cowichan Valley Basket Society and Red Cross are accepting monetary donations.
